Today we are doing our draft horse chores with our grandchildren and sharing the love of horses with the next generation! Our grandkids are up for Thanksgiving and they are getting very good at doing the morning horse chores, brushing horses, and they each wanted a chance to sit on the horses' backs!

Watch our videos to learn about draft horses- horse logging, horses farming, and horse training! Jim uses Belgian, Percheron, and Suffolk horses to do work on the farm and in the woods. He teaches about harnesses, horse-drawn logging and farming equipment, horse feeding and maintenance, and voice commands for horses. New videos uploaded every week. Keep watching to see how Jim trains his new Suffolk Punch colts as he has trained his full-grown teams!
